Margaret Germaine / Jermain was born in New York, a daughter of Isaac Germaine / Jermain and his wife. On September 29, 1725, Margaret married Jacob Titus, of Long Island, New York. Margaret's husband is DAR Ancestor #A116011. Children of Margaret and Jacob include:
Margaret Titus, who married Isaac Robbins
Timothy Titus, born 1726, who married Charity Losee
Philadelphia Titus, who married Adam Carman
Sarah Titus, who married Joseph Doty
Jacob Titus, buried June 5, 1808, married Martha Keen, on March 4, 1769
Phebe Titus, who married Silas Rushmore
Samuel Titus, whose wife's name is Mary
Elizabeth Titus, who married Samuel Crooker, on June 12, 1777
Researcher's Notes
Margaret's last name is listed as "Jermain" by the DAR, however the DAR assigns a single standard surname that covers variant spellings of similar surnames.
Pendery, Joyce S., German/Jarman Family of Hempstead, Long Island, Greenwich, Connecticut, and Cincinnati, Ohio, Connecticut Ancestry (Connecticut Ancestry Society, Inc., Stamford, Conn., Dec 2004) Vol. 47, No. 2.
Page 143. Jacob Titus m. Margaret German b. c.1705 prob. Hempstead, d. 1777 poss. New York, dau. of Charles and Rachel (____) German
Page 141. Might be confused with Margaret, dau. of Charles2. One of the Margaret Germans marr. Jacob Tittus by 1726, bef. Isaac wrote his will. Isaac refers to his daughter only as Margaret.
